Transaction f4b5934491714823eae41c16c30d01e8fb6a592442782168f5d4ad594e179963

1 Input
2 Outputs
  • f4b5934491714823eae41c16c30d01e8fb6a592442782168f5d4ad594e179963:0
  • value  9575800
    address  15sMLKBh7Rw5bLCoUJPhSnf9A5rtRRADQ2
  • f4b5934491714823eae41c16c30d01e8fb6a592442782168f5d4ad594e179963:1
  • value  680
    address  3CYYWw5VtNhV7J5EMjzK7bP83DV3tWuYam